ALARM
SYSTEM*
Setting and de-activating
the alarm
Switching off the siren.
The
alarm
completes
the safety equipment
of your
vehicle. It comprises two
types
of pro-
tection:
- exterior
protection:
when this is set the
alarm sounds
if
a
door,
the
bonnet or the
boot are
opened;
-
interior
sensor
protection:
when
it
is
set,
the alarm sounds if the sensors detect
a
variation
in the air movement
inside the
vehicle
(breaking
of a window)
or a
movement
inside
the vehicle.
It
is also
equipped
with an
anti-tamper
func-
tion.
If an attempt is made to neutralize the leads
to the
siren,
the
central
control or the battery:
- the alarm is triggered
-
the siren
sounds,
the head-lights come
on'.
If an
attempt
is made to neutralize the wires
to the direction
indicators:
- the alarm is not
triggered.

To set the alarm
(exterior
and interior
protection)
The ignition
must be switched
off. You
must be outside
the
vehicle.
Press the
locking button
of the remote
control
key (if your vehicle is
equipped with
one,
if is
then necessary
to press the deadlocking
button).
The doors will lock.
The
direction
indicators come
on
continuously
for
two seconds.
The
red lamp on
the
switch
flashes once a
second.
Five seconds afterwards: the exterior
protec-
tion is
set.
50 seconds afterwards: the interior protection
is set.
Note:
when the
alarm
is triggered the
siren
sounds
for
thirty
seconds.
It
then
stops.

Warning
If,
on setting the
alarm, a
door,
the
boot
or
the bonnet
are
not
properly closed,
the siren
will
be triggered briefly.
It
the
vehicle
is
prop-
erly closed
within
45 seconds after
this,
the
alarm is
set,
the
direction
indicators come on
continuously
for
two
seconds.
In
all
cases the alarm is
set
45 seconds after-
wards.
